首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Hyperlink -如何使用条件禁用href按钮(javascript)

Hyperlink是指超链接,它是在网页中实现页面之间跳转的一种方式。在HTML中,我们可以使用<a>标签来创建超链接。通常情况下,超链接会以蓝色字体显示,并且在鼠标悬停时会有下划线效果。

如果我们想要在特定条件下禁用超链接的href按钮,可以使用JavaScript来实现。下面是一种常见的实现方式:

代码语言:txt
复制
// 获取超链接元素
var link = document.getElementById("myLink");

// 检查条件并禁用超链接
if (条件) {
  link.removeAttribute("href"); // 移除href属性
  link.style.pointerEvents = "none"; // 禁用鼠标事件
  link.style.color = "gray"; // 修改颜色以表示禁用状态
}

在上述代码中,我们首先通过getElementById方法获取到超链接元素,然后根据特定条件判断是否需要禁用超链接。如果条件满足,我们使用removeAttribute方法移除href属性,这样点击超链接时将不会跳转到指定页面。接着,我们使用style属性来修改pointerEvents属性为"none",这样可以禁用鼠标事件,使超链接看起来像是被禁用的状态。最后,我们可以通过修改color属性来改变超链接的颜色,以进一步表示禁用状态。

需要注意的是,上述代码中的"myLink"应该替换为实际超链接元素的id。

在腾讯云的产品中,与超链接相关的产品是腾讯云CDN(内容分发网络)。CDN可以加速网站的访问速度,提高用户体验。您可以通过以下链接了解更多关于腾讯云CDN的信息:腾讯云CDN产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券